The Union Public Service Commission, Civil Services Examination (UPSC CSE) is a highly coveted and competitive examination that selects candidates for many different posts in the Indian Civil Services. UPSC CSE is conducted in three stages – Prelims, Mains, and Personality Test/Interview. The exam is known for its rigorous evaluation process and is considered one of the toughest examinations in India. It attracts thousands of candidates every year who aspire to become administrators, police officers, foreign service officers, and other high-ranking officials in the Indian bureaucracy.

UPSC CSE 2024 will be an opportunity for aspiring candidates to showcase their knowledge and skills in various fields such as history, politics, geography, economics, science, and technology. The preliminary exam will be conducted on 16th June 2024 and it is an objective type test comprising two papers – General Studies Paper-I and General Studies Paper-II (CSAT). Candidates qualifying for the prelims would be eligible for the mains exam. The Mains exam will consist of nine papers, including an essay paper, two language papers, four General Studies papers, and two optional papers chosen by the candidate. The final stage of the examination will be the personality test/interview, which will be conducted for candidates who have qualified for the Mains examination.

UPSC CSE Eligibility Criteria

Candidates appearing for the UPSC CSE exam must go through the eligibility criteria before moving on to the registration process. a candidate’s eligibility will be measured on 4 grounds i.e., educational qualifications, age limit, nationality, and the number of attempts. The candidate must pass through all these criteria in order to appear for the UPSC CSE examination.

Education Qualification

The UPSC exam does not require applicants to possess an extensive educational qualification certificate. Candidates must have a graduation-level degree from a government-recognized or UGC-approved university, irrespective of the branch of study. Applicants who are in their last year of graduation can also apply for UPSC CSE, as long as they receive their graduation results before the final exam.

Nationality

The candidate must meet one of the following criteria:

1.         The candidate must be a citizen of India.

2.       The candidate must be a subject of Nepal, Bhutan, Bangladesh refugee who came to India before 1st January 1962 with the intention to settle permanently.

3.        A person of Indian origin who has migrated from Burma, Pakistan, Sri Lanka, and East African countries such as Kenya, Uganda, Zambia, Malawi, Ethiopia, Zaire, or Vietnam with the intention to settle permanently in India.

Number of Attempts

1.         The General Category is provided with 6 attempts in total.

2.       The EWS and OBC categories are provided with 9 attempts in total.

3.        The SC/ST category has unlimited attempts till they reach 37 years of age.

 

UPSC CSE 2024 Vacancies

The Union Public Service Commission has announced 1105 UPSC Civil Services vacancies for 2024 for the posts of IAS, IPS, IFS, IRS, etc. The number has increased from the previously notified 816 vacancies.  37 vacancies will be reserved for the Persons with Disabilities category, the breakdown being: Deaf and Hard of Hearing – 05 vacancies, Locomotor Disability – 15 Vacancies, Multiple Disabilities – 10 vacancies, Blindness and Low Vision – 07.

UPSC CSE Exam Pattern

Please find below the exam pattern for UPSC CSE. Additionally, you can refer to the Indian Administrative Services Exam Pattern.

Prelims Exam Pattern

  • Both Paper 1 and 2 have a system of negative marking, where an incorrect answer leads to a deduction of one-third (0.33) of the marks assigned to the corresponding question.
  • GS Paper II (CSAT) is considered qualifying, and candidates must obtain a minimum score of 33% to pass it.

The detailed exam pattern is outlined below:

Paper

No. of Questions

Total Marks

Duration

General Studies Paper I

100

200

2 hours

General Studies Paper II (CSAT)

80

200

2 hours  

Mains Exam Pattern

  • Candidates taking the CSE main examination are required to take qualifying papers in Indian Language and English.
  • The minimum score required on each paper is 25%.
  • Essay, General Studies, and optional papers are included in the merit-based papers.
  • The duration for each paper is 3 hours.
  • Candidates from Sikkim, Manipur, Meghalaya, Mizoram, Nagaland, and Arunachal Pradesh are exempted from taking the Indian Language paper.

UPSC CSE Syllabus 2024

The Preliminary examination for the Civil Services comprises of two papers commonly referred to as the Civil Services Aptitude Test (CSAT). These papers are categorized as general studies and cover a range of topics.

UPSC CSE Prelims Syllabus

The UPSC CSE Prelims syllabus is as follows:

Paper 1

     General Science
     Current events of national and international importance
     Indian and World Geography- Physical, Social, Economic
     Indian Polity and Governance- Constitution, Public Policy, Political System, Panchayati Raj, Rights Issues, etc.
     General issues on Ecology, Environment, Biodiversity and Climate Change (no subject specialization required)
     Economic and Social Development- Social Sector Initiatives, Sustainable Development, Poverty, Inclusion, Demographics, etc.
History of India and Indian National Movement

Paper 2

     Comprehension
     General mental ability
     Logical reasoning and analytical ability
     Basic numeracy (numbers and their relations, etc. — Class X level)
     Data interpretation
     Tables, charts, graphs, data sufficiency etc. — (Class X
     level)
     Decision making and problem-solving
Interpersonal skills including communication skills

Preparation Tips for UPSC CSE 2024

If you are planning to take the UPSC Civil Services Examination (CSE) in 2024, then be aware that it is one of the most highly competitive exams in India. Achieving success in this exam demands a methodical approach and unwavering commitment. To assist you in preparing for the UPSC CSE 2024, here are a few tips:

  • Understand the syllabus: Before you start preparing, make sure you have a good understanding of the UPSC CSE syllabus. The syllabus is vast and covers a wide range of topics, so it’s essential to know what to focus on.
  • Make a study plan: Once you understand the syllabus, make a study plan. Break down the syllabus into smaller, manageable sections and allocate time for each. Ensure that you allocate enough time for revision and practice.
  • Read newspapers and current affairs: Read newspapers and magazines regularly to stay up-to-date with current events. Focus on issues that are relevant to the UPSC CSE syllabus.
  • Refer to NCERT books: NCERT books are a great source of information and are recommended by UPSC. Read the NCERT books for relevant subjects thoroughly to build your foundational knowledge.
  • Choose the right study material: To perform well in the exam, it is crucial to select study materials that comprehensively cover the syllabus and are easy to comprehend. A clear comprehension of concepts is imperative for achieving high scores.
  • Practice writing: Writing practice is crucial for UPSC CSE. Write answers to previous years’ question papers, and get them evaluated by an experienced mentor. Your answer-writing skills will improve as you identify your strengths and weaknesses.
  • Test yourself: Take mock tests regularly to assess your preparation level. This will also help you manage time better during the actual exam.

Stay motivated: Preparing for UPSC CSE can be overwhelming, so it’s important to stay motivated. Surround yourself with positive people, take breaks when needed, and remember why you started preparing for the exam in the first place
